Abstract:Hirschheim, Klein and Lyytinen approach a central topic of interest in the discussion about information systems: What is information systems development (ISD) and how can the field of ISD research dealing with this question be structured? As researchers in this field the authors share their basic concern, and as the authors perceive the implementation of computer applications not only in its technical dimension but in its social dimensions as well, they appreciate Hirschheim, Klein, and Lyytinen's discussion of interdisciplinary approaches necessary for understanding the interrelation between technology and society, between computer applications and users in their organizations.
